What is an SIP Calculator?
An SIP (Systematic Investment Plan) calculator is an online tool that helps you estimate the future value of your SIP investments. By inputting key details like the monthly investment amount, expected rate of return, and investment tenure, the calculator provides an estimate of how much your investments will grow over a specific period. This makes it easier to plan for long-term financial goals such as buying a home, funding your child's education, or building a retirement corpus.
How Does an SIP Calculator Work?
An SIP Calculator works on the principle of compound interest, where the returns generated from your investments are reinvested to earn more returns. The calculator uses the following formula to compute the future value of your SIP investments:
